If you get standalone management with cable throttle body, then you can add on ITBs and really agressive cams with mapping to suit. OR a turbo should you win the lottery.

If you leave it as FBW throttle and standard ECU, then you keep the "toys" and you can only add medium road cams and a remap.

If you have less than £800-£1k to spend the best you can do IMO is a custom remap or a really cost-effective RStuner remap

Depends what you want from the car mate. 420's give a more spread torque curve, 428's are peaky and you sacrifice low down to gain higher up. Personally, I'd stick 428's in, battery in the boot to get a straighter inlet tract and get the car live mapped. If you had a package, you'll get a flashed ECU with the cams map on it, which is great but if you got cams direct and got the Kevs to fit them, then drove to Paul @RStuning or similar to get it live mapped, you'll get better gains and driveablilty.

Live maps cost more but are well worth it.
